.bg_gradient{
background: rgb(0,149,182);
background: -moz-linear-gradient(90deg, rgba(0,149,182,1) 0%, rgba(59,89,151,1) 100%);
background: -webkit-linear-gradient(90deg, rgba(0,149,182,1) 0%, rgba(59,89,151,1) 100%);
background: linear-gradient(90deg, rgba(0,149,182,1) 0%, rgba(59,89,151,1) 100%);
filter: progid:DXImageTransform.Microsoft.gradient(startColorstr="#0095b6",endColorstr="#3b5997",GradientType=1);
}
.normal-case {
  text-transform: none;
}
.mediumBodyText{
    font-size: 22px;
  font-weight: 300;
}
.mediumHeadText{
  font-size:50px;
}
.link_text{
  color:#fff;
}
#hero{
 
}
@media (max-width: 1399px) {
  #hero h1{
    font-size:42px;
  }
  #hero{

  }
}
@media (max-width: 1199px) {
  #hero{
  }
  #hero h1{
    font-size:36px;
  }
}
@media (max-width: 991px) {
  #hero h1{
    font-size:24px;
  }
  .hero-text{
    font-size:16px;
  }
}
@media (max-width: 767px) {
  #hero{
  }
  #heroBtnCon{
    text-align:center;
    width:285px;
  }
  
  #heroImage{
    padding:0 0px 0px 0px;
  }
  #heroLinkCon{
		/*font-size:22px;*/
		text-align: left;
    color: #fff;
	}
  #hero_cont_con{
  padding:0 50px;
  }
  
}

@media (max-width: 575px) {
   #hero_cont_con{
  padding:0 50px;
  }
/*.bg_gradient{
  border-bottom-left-radius: 20%;
  border-bottom-right-radius: 20%;
  }*/
}
@media (max-width: 440px) {
   #hero{
  }
  #heroBtnCon{
    text-align:center;
    width:200px;
  }
  
  #heroImage{
    padding:0 0px 0px 0px;
  }
  #heroLinkCon{
		font-size:22px;
		text-align: left;
    color: #fff;
	}
  #hero_cont_con{
  padding:0 50px;
  }
  
}

}
